Cover for James Allan Carroll's Obituary
James Allan Carroll Profile Photo
1950 James Allan Carroll 2025

James Allan Carroll

April 30, 1950 — December 5, 2025

Guestbook

Visits: 4

This site is protected by reCAPTCHA and the
Google Privacy Policy and Terms of Service apply.

Service map data © OpenStreetMap contributors